New Paper Alert! In this publication at the #Journal of #Hydrology, led by TangWei, we have shown how decades of effective #water management stategies in northern #China led to reversal of land #subsidence UNESCO Land Subsidence International Initiative Mahdi Motagh Link--> authors.elsevier.com/c/1jZqg52cufA80
